Although it can rarely be claimed to be tiny (it covers around 10 acres/ 4 hectares), lots of people are unaware of the cemetery's presence. One of the oldest Catholic burial grounds in Toronto, it was established in the mid-1800s because of the lots of Irish immigrants to the city who unfortunately passed away quickly after their arrival.

Integrated in the late 1980s, the arena is kept in mind for its completely retractable motorised roof covering and for being the very first arena of its kind in the world. Throughout building and construction, many historical artefacts were found in the ground, including pottery and cannonballs. The stadium is made use of for different showing off events, consisting of baseball, basketball, soccer, football, cricket, and tennis.

The round battery was constructed in 1811. In 1812 the United States stated battle and Ft York was attacked in 1813. The ft was eventually caught and ruined. It was restored in 1814 and the battle consequently ended. Supports were strengthened over later years when trouble seemed impending. The fortress was brought back in the early 1900s as an event of the including of the city.
Today, some of the frameworks within the complicated are amongst the earliest buildings in Toronto. Visitors can discover the as soon as magnificent citadel and see a selection of artefacts and military memorabilia.
